A Tale of Two Worlds
Echoes reintroduces gamers to bounty hunter Samus Aran, this time dispatched to the mysterious Earth Aether to investigate the disappearance of the Galactic Federation squad. What begins for a reconnaissance mission immediately unravels into a struggle towards a powerful, corrupting power referred to as Darkish Aether — a twisted mirror Variation of the principle world. This dual-entire world mechanic gets to be central to the game’s structure and narrative.
Navigating among Mild and Dark Aether provides a abundant layer of strategic complexity. Gamers need to control well being whilst exploring the harmful environment of Dark Aether, depending on Safe and sound zones to survive. This duality creates a powerful thrust-pull dynamic, forcing players to equilibrium possibility and reward in Every single natural environment.
Gameplay Innovation and Problem
Developing on the profitable very first-person experience framework of its predecessor, Echoes retains the immersive exploration and scanning mechanics that enthusiasts loved, though incorporating new weapons, suit updates, and puzzles. Even so, the biggest evolution emanates from its trouble and complexity.
Echoes is noted for its steep challenge, both equally in fight and environmental puzzles. Enemies strike tougher, help save details are scarcer, and the game calls for eager observation and timing. New additions like the Light Beam and Dark Beam not simply improve battle selection but also are important for resolving puzzles and unlocking doors within the corresponding realm. The clever interplay involving weapons and environments provides depth into the classic Metroidvania formula.
Manager battles are An additional highlight, giving multi-period encounters that exam both reflexes and strategic considering. The introduction in the villainous Ing — shadowy beings from Dark Aether — gives a menacing and thematically reliable enemy pressure. These creatures, combined with the recurring risk of Dim Samus, increase to the sport’s oppressive SODO atmosphere.
Ambiance and Worldbuilding
From its moody soundtrack to its alien architecture, Metroid Primary two: Echoes is steeped in ambiance. The game’s artwork course paints Aether being a planet of stark contrasts — serene and mystical in Light Aether, desolate and foreboding in its darkish counterpart. This visual storytelling is complemented via the sequence’ trademark use of scanning, allowing gamers to piece collectively lore organically and uncover the tragic background of your Luminoth, Aether’s native inhabitants.
